Moist Apple Cinnamon Coffee Cake Recipe
This Moist Apple Cinnamon Coffee Cake is a delightful baked treat featuring tender cake layers infused with cinnamon and studded with juicy chopped apples. The combination of cinnamon-spiced apple topping and a soft, buttery crumb makes it perfect for breakfast, brunch, or an afternoon snack with coffee or tea.

Cake Batter
- 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 2 cups gran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up buttermilk
Apple Cinnamon Topping
- 2 cups chopped apples
- 1/2 cup packed light brown sugar
- 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 cup chopped pecans (optional)
- Preheat and prepare pan: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9×13 inch baking pan to prevent sticking and ensure easy removal of the cake after baking.
- Cream butter and sugar: In a large b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ar using a mixer until the mixture is light and fluffy. This step incorporates air into the batter helping the cake rise.
- Add eggs and vanilla: Beat in the eggs one at a time, ensuring each is fully incorporated before adding the next. Stir in the vanilla extract for flavor.
- Combine dry 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. This ensures even distribution of leavening agents.
- Mix dry and wet ingredients: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with the buttermilk. Start and finish with the dry ingredients to maintain batter consistency. Mix just until combined to avoid overworking the gluten.
- Prepare apple cinnamon mixture: In a small bowl, combine the chopped apples, brown sugar, cinnamon, and the additional 1/4 cup flour. Add chopped pecans if using to add crunch and flavor.
- Assemble the cake layers: Spread half of the cake batter evenly into the prepared baking pan. Then, sprinkle half of the apple cinnamon mixture over the batter. Spread the remaining cake batter over the apples, followed by topping with the remaining apple cinnamon mixture.
- Bake the cake: Place the pan in the preheated oven and bake for 45-55 minutes or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ean, indicating the cake is done.
- Cool before serving: Let the cake c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ely before slicing and serving. This helps the cake set and makes it easier to cut.
Notes
- Ensure your butter and eggs are at room temperature for the best cake texture and proper creaming.
- Don’t overmix the batter once the flour is added to avoid a dense cake.
- You can use any type of apple that holds its shape when baked, like Honeycrisp or Gala, for best texture.
- For an extra cinnamon kick, dust the cooled cake with a little additional cinnamon sugar.
- Chopped pecans add a nice crunch but are optional based on preference or nut allergies.
